Core Components of the 2026 Marketing Plan Format
1. Executive Summary (AI-Summarized)
Generate this section last using your AI insights dashboard. It should be under 250 words and auto-generated from the full plan. Include:
- Campaign name and code
- Target market(s)
- Core KPIs: CAC, ROI, CLV, MER (Marketing Efficiency Ratio)
- Budget allocation (total and channel split)
- Expected outcome (e.g., “Increase MER by 22% YoY”)
Example:
"Project Aurora: A 2026 omnichannel campaign targeting Gen Z gamers in North America. KPIs: CAC ≤ $18, ROI ≥ 5.2, MER improvement from 1.4 to 1.7. Budget: $1.2M across TikTok, Discord, and in-game activations. Expected outcome: 45% uplift in lifetime engagement."

3. SMART+ Goals for 2026
Use the SMART+ framework: Specific, Measurable, Achievable, Relevant, Time-bound, and AI-augmented.
| Goal | KPI | AI Augmentation |
|---|---|---|
| Increase organic search traffic by 40% | Sessions, bounce rate | Use SEMrush’s AI keyword clustering |
| Reduce CAC by 15% in EU markets | CAC per channel | Implement predictive bidding with StackAdapt AI |
| Boost email open rates to 28% | Open rate, A/B test winner | Use AI subject line generator (e.g., Phrasee) |
| Grow Discord server to 50k members | Net new members, engagement rate | Deploy AI moderator + content scheduler |

Measurement & Optimization: The AI Dashboard
8. Key Metrics Dashboard (Live & Auto-Generated)
| Metric | Definition | 2026 Target | AI Tool |
|---|---|---|---|
| MER (Marketing Efficiency Ratio) | Revenue generated per dollar spent | ≥ 1.7 | Google Analytics 4 + Windsor.ai |
| CAC (Customer Acquisition Cost) | Cost to acquire a customer | ≤ $15 (US), ≤ $22 (EU) | StackAdapt AI + CRM |
| CLV (Customer Lifetime Value) | Predicted revenue per customer | ↑ 25% YoY | C3 AI Predictive CLV |
| Engagement Rate (AI Score) | AI-calculated emotional sentiment score | ≥ 4.2/5 | Brandwatch + Hive AI |
| Zero-Click Attribution | Searches that result in no click (e.g., SGE) | Track % and optimize | Google Search Console + AI summaries |
Pro Tip: Use AI anomaly detection (e.g., Datadog AI) to flag sudden drops in CTR or spikes in CAC. Set alerts for deviations >15%.
Risk Management & Compliance in 2026
9. AI & Privacy Compliance Checklist
- GDPR & CCPA: Ensure AI models are trained on anonymized data; use differential privacy where needed
- EU AI Act: Classify your AI tools (e.g., chatbots = limited risk, predictive models = high risk)
- Transparency: Disclose AI-generated content with #AIgenerated tags on social media
- Bias Audit: Run IBM AI Fairness 360 or Microsoft Fairlearn on all customer-facing AI
- Data Residency: Store EU user data in EU data centers; use AWS EU (Stockholm) or Google Cloud EU

Q: How do I handle AI hallucinations in customer-facing content?
Implement a human-in-the-loop workflow:
- AI generates draft
- Human reviews and edits
- AI refines based on feedback
- Deploy with disclaimer: “Content generated with AI assistance”
